Output 40303072541223e775e86d3beff36f16a77a8fc65b2f14f5fe6cd7b91aacf626:0

value
59899808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a524764882df714fe75ffbf676bfcc6f382a2968 OP_EQUAL
address
MNxMQWVzHeSbwz3ViAeaAxyZNbdrnnPwYZ
transaction
40303072541223e775e86d3beff36f16a77a8fc65b2f14f5fe6cd7b91aacf626
spent
true